本實用新型專利技術公開了一種基于SOPC的點對多點系統動態幀結構模塊,包括控制器(1)、FLASH存儲器(2)、串口芯片(3)、無線發送模塊(4)、無線接收模塊(5)、幀結構配置模塊(6)和電源(12)。它采用SOPC軟件方法實現點對多點TDD系統時隙的動態分配協議,實現了時隙的動態靈活劃分,提高了點對多點系統的傳輸效率,提高了系統容量。具有實現簡單、傳輸效率較高、性能穩定可靠、容量易于擴展等優點,在點對多點TDD通信系統中有著比較廣泛的應用前途。(*該技術在2022年保護過期,可自由使用*)
【技術實現步驟摘要】
本技術涉及點對多點系統通信中的一種靈活、高效、實用、可靠的幀結構模塊,實現了靈活方便地配置幀結構參數,實現了點對多點TDD系統時隙的動態靈活劃分,提高了點對多點系統的傳輸效率,提高了系統容量。
技術介紹
傳統的點對多點TDD系統幀結構一般采用固定分配如TDMA或者輪詢協議,固定分配的幀結構不夠靈活,在系統容量較低時傳輸效率較低,時間資源浪費較嚴重;輪詢協議在系統容量較高時額外開銷引起的浪費較嚴重,傳輸效率變低;這兩種方式幀結構固定,不能隨系統容量變化相應變化,靈活性較差。
技術實現思路
本技術的目的在于避免上述
技術介紹
中的不足之處而提供了一種利用SOPC(可編程片上系統)技術的點對多點系統動態幀結構實現方法,具有簡單、靈活、高效、可靠等優點。本技術完全解決了傳統的幀結構設計復雜、靈活性差、效率較低的問題。本技術的目的是這樣實現的:一種基于SOPC的點對多點系統動態幀結構模塊,包括控制器1、FLASH存儲器2、串口芯片3、無線發送模塊4、無線接收模塊5、幀結構配置模塊6和電源12,其特征在于:所述的控制器I的輸出端口 I輸出時序操作控制信號和需要燒寫的幀結構參數數據至FLASH存儲器2的輸入端口 I ;FLASH存儲器2的輸出端口 2將存儲的幀結構參數信息返回到控制器I的輸入端口 2 ;控制器I的輸出端口 3輸出幀結構參數監控數據至串口芯片3的輸入端口 I ;串口芯片3的輸出端口 2輸出幀結構參數配置數據至控制器I的輸入端口 4 ;控制器I的輸出端口 5輸出巾貞結構參數到無線發送模塊4的輸入端口 I ;控制器I的輸出端口6輸出復接數據到無線發送模塊4的輸入端口 2,無線發送模塊4的輸出端口 3將數據流轉換成電平信號發送到無線信道中;控制器I的輸出端口 7輸出幀結構參數到無線接收模塊5的輸入端口 I ;無線接收模塊5的輸入端口 3接收無線信道的電平信號進行解調處理,無線接收模塊5的輸出端口 2輸出輸出解調數據流到控制器I的輸入端口 8 ;串口芯片3的輸出端口 3輸出幀結構參數監控數據到幀結構配置模塊6的輸入端口 I ;幀結構配置模塊6通過輸出端口 2輸出幀結構參數配置數據到串口芯片3的輸入端口 4 ;電源12輸出端+V電壓端與各部件相應電源端并接,提供各個部件需要的電源。其中,控制器I包括NIOS II處理器模塊7、片內雙口 RAM存儲器8、片內雙口 RAM存儲器管理接口模塊9、數據發送接收配置模塊10、片外FLASH存儲器控制模塊11、串口芯片控制模塊13、數據發送模塊14和數據接收模塊15 ;所述的串口芯片3對接收的幀結構配置參數數據,在串口芯片控制模塊13的控制下將幀結構配置參數數據讀入進行協議解析處理,串口芯片控制模塊13將處理后的幀結構配置參數數據發送到NIOSII處理器模塊7 ;NIOS II處理器模塊7將輸入的處理后的幀結構配置參數數據送入片外FLASH存儲器控制模塊11進行并串處理,片外FLASH存儲器控制模塊11將串行的幀結構配置參數數據燒寫入FLASH存儲器2中完成數據的存儲;N10S II處理器模塊7通過片外FLASH存儲器控制模塊11將FLASH存儲器2中存儲的串行的幀結構參數數據讀出,通過數據發送接收配置模塊10分別對數據發送模塊14和數據接收模塊15進行參數配置;N10S II處理器模塊7通過片內雙口 RAM存儲器管理接口模塊9將幀頭、信令和業務數據信息數據寫入雙口 RAM存儲器8 ;數據發送模塊14將片內雙口 RAM存儲器8中的數據讀入,進行處理后轉換成串行比特流數據發送到無線發送模塊4 ;無線接收模塊5接收信道中的無線電信號,轉換成串行比特流數據發送到數據接收模塊15 ;數據接收模塊15接收串行比特流數據后經過處理將數據寫入片內雙口 RAM存儲器8 ;N10S II處理器模塊7通過片內雙口 RAM存儲器管理接口模塊9從雙口 RAM存儲器8中讀取數據進行處理,解析出幀頭、信令和業務數據信息數據;NIOS II處理器模塊7將幀結構參數監控數據送入串口芯片控制模塊13進行并串轉換和協議轉換,串口芯片控制模塊13將處理后串行數據流發送到串口芯片3。本技術相比
技術介紹
具有如下優點:1.本技術設計靈活,可滿足不同系統容量的需求,傳輸效率較高。2.本技術的主要部分采用已有的大規模現場可編程器件,設計簡單,可封裝成模塊,便于移植。3.本技術主要是軟件實現,幀結構參數配置靈活,適應性較強。附圖說明圖1是本技術電原理方框圖。圖2是本技術控制器I實施例的電原理圖。具體實施方式參照圖1、圖2,本技術由控制器1、FLASH存儲器2、串口芯片3、無線發送模塊4、無線接收模塊5、幀結構配置模塊6和電源12組成。圖1是本技術的電原理方框圖,實施例按圖1連接線路。其中控制器I的作用是通過端口 I輸出FLASH存儲器2的讀寫信號、地址和數據信號,通過端口 2輸入FLASH存儲器2存儲的幀結構參數數據,通過這兩個端口完成對FLASH存儲器2的讀寫操作;控制器I通過端口 3完成對串口芯片3的幀結構參數監控數據發送工作,通過端口 4完成對串口芯片3的幀結構參數配置數據的輸入工作。控制器I由包括NIOS II處理器模塊7、片內雙口 RAM存儲器8、片內雙口 RAM存儲器管理接口模塊9、數據發送接收配置模塊10、片外FLASH存儲器控制模塊11、串口芯片控制模塊13、數據發送模塊14、數據接收模塊15組成。實施例控制器I采用美國Altera公司生產Cyclone II系列FPGA芯片制作。圖2是本技術控制器I的電原理圖,實施例按圖2連接線路。NIOS II處理器模塊7的作用是完成幀結構參數的讀取與配置、幀結構參數配置的接收與存儲、基于TDD的動態時隙分配協議處理、無線數據的組幀、無線數據的幀解析;片內雙口 RAM存儲器8用來存儲NIOS II處理器模塊7寫入的的幀數據,以供數據發送模塊14發送處理,片內雙口 RAM存儲器8同時將數據接收模塊15接收到的數據存儲,以供存儲NIOSII處理器模塊7讀取處理;雙口 RAM存儲器管理接口模塊9用于完成NIOSII處理器模塊7對片內雙口 RAM存儲器8的操作控制;數據發送接收配置模塊10用于完成NIOS II處理器模塊7對數據發送模塊14、數據接收模塊15的參數配置;片外FLASH存儲器控制模塊11完成對FLASH存儲器2的時序控制功能;串口芯片控制模塊13完成對串口芯片3的數據接收與數據發送功能;數據發送模塊14完成幀數據的并串轉換和比特流發送功能;數據接收模塊15完成幀數據的比特流接收和串并轉換功能。實例實施采用一塊美國Altera公司生產Cyclone II系列FPGA芯片制作。FLASH存儲器2用于存儲幀結構參數,以供控制器I完成幀結構參數的讀取、更新和配置使用。實例實施采用XICOR公司的X4045集成芯片實現。本技術中串口芯片3接收來自控制器I輸出的幀結構參數監控數據,由端口2輸出給控制器I參數配置數據。實施例采用MAXM公司的MAX3237EEAI集成芯片實現。本技術電源12提供整個點對多點系統動態幀結構模塊電路的直流工作電壓,實施例采用市售通用集成穩壓直流電源塊制作,其輸出+V電壓為+3.本文檔來自技高網...
【技術保護點】
一種基于SOPC的點對多點系統動態幀結構模塊,包括控制器(1)、FLASH存儲器(2)、串口芯片(3)、無線發送模塊(4)、無線接收模塊(5)、幀結構配置模塊(6)和電源(12),其特征在于:所述的控制器(1)的輸出端口1輸出時序操作控制信號和需要燒寫的幀結構參數數據至FLASH存儲器(2)的輸入端口1;FLASH存儲器(2)的輸出端口2將存儲的幀結構參數信息返回到控制器(1)的輸入端口2;控制器(1)的輸出端口3輸出幀結構參數監控數據至串口芯片(3)的輸入端口1;串口芯片(3)的輸出端口2輸出幀結構參數配置數據至控制器(1)的輸入端口4;控制器(1)的輸出端口5輸出幀結構參數到無線發送模塊(4)的輸入端口1;控制器(1)的輸出端口6輸出復接數據到無線發送模塊(4)的輸入端口2,無線發送模塊(4)的輸出端口3將數據流轉換成電平信號發送到無線信道中;控制器(1)的輸出端口7輸出幀結構參數到無線接收模塊(5)的輸入端口1;無線接收模塊(5)的輸入端口3接收無線信道的電平信號進行解調處理,無線接收模塊(5)的輸出端口2輸出輸出解調數據流到控制器(1)的輸入端口8;串口芯片(3)的輸出端口3輸出幀結構參數監控數據到幀結構配置模塊(6)的輸入端口1;幀結構配置模塊(6)通過輸出端口2輸出幀結構參數配置數據到串口芯片(3)的輸入端口4;電源(12)輸出端+V電壓端與各部件相應電源端并接,提供各個部件需要的電源。...
【技術特征摘要】
1.一種基于SOPC的點對多點系統動態幀結構模塊,包括控制器(I)、FLASH存儲器(2)、串口芯片(3)、無線發送模塊(4)、無線接收模塊(5)、幀結構配置模塊(6)和電源(12),其特征在于:所述的控制器⑴的輸出端口 I輸出時序操作控制信號和需要燒寫的幀結構參數數據至FLASH存儲器(2)的輸入端口 I ;FLASH存儲器(2)的輸出端口 2將存儲的幀結構參數信息返回到控制器(I)的輸入端口 2 ;控制器(I)的輸出端口 3輸出幀結構參數監控數據至串口芯片(3)的輸入端口 I ;串口芯片(3)的輸出端口 2輸出幀結構參數配置數據至控制器(I)的輸入端口 4;控制器(I)的輸出端口 5輸出幀結構參數到無線發送模塊(4)的輸入端口 I ;控制器(I)的輸出端口 6輸出復接數據到無線發送模塊(4)的輸入端口 2,無線發送模塊(4)的輸出端口 3將數據流轉換成電平信號發送到無線信道中;控制器(I)的輸出端口 7輸出幀結構參數到無線接收模塊(5)的輸入端口 I ;無線接收模塊(5)的輸入端口 3接收無線信道的電平信號進行解調處理,無線接收模塊(5)的輸出端口 2輸出輸出解調數據流到控制器(I)的輸入端口 8 ;串口芯片(3)的輸出端口 3輸出幀結構參數監控數據到幀結構配置模塊(6)的輸入端口 I ;幀結構配置模塊(6)通過輸出端口 2輸出幀結構參數配置數據到串口芯片(3)的輸入端口 4;電源(12)輸出端+V電壓端與各部件相應電源端并接,提供各個部件需要的電源。2.根據權利要求1所述的一種基于SOPC的點對多點系統動態幀結構模塊,其特征在于:控制器(I)包括NIOS II處理器模塊(7)、片內雙口 RAM存儲器(8)、片內雙口 RAM存儲器管理接口模塊(9)、數據發送接收配置模塊(10)、片外F...
【專利技術屬性】
技術研發人員:楊喜光,邵華斌,呂先望,
申請(專利權)人:中國電子科技集團公司第五十四研究所,
類型:實用新型
國別省市:
還沒有人留言評論。發表了對其他瀏覽者有用的留言會獲得科技券。